[Animation] Track frames zoom in to max upon resizing Animation window
Animation track frames zoom in to max upon resizing Animation window.
Steps to reproduce:
1. Create a new project.
2. Go to > Window > Animation > Animation.
3. Click on Main Camera game object.
4. Click on Create button in the Animation window.
5. Click on 'Save' to save the animation clip.
6. Shrink the animation window till the track window part gets hide then expand it.
Note:
1. Video is attached for the reference.
2. Occurring with both scenarios, docking and undocking animation window.
Actual result:
Animation track frames zoom in to max upon resizing Animation window.
Expected result:
Animation track frames do not zoom-in/zoom-out when window resized.
Reproducible in:
2019.3.0a2, 2019.2.0b1, 2019.1.0f2, 2018.3.0f2, 2018.1.9f1
Environment:
Windows and Mac
